06Recent Price History

DateHigh (₹)Low (₹)Average (₹)
11 Aug ₹26,669 ₹2,519 ₹16,899
07 Aug ₹16,856 ₹4,569 ₹12,769
31 Jul ₹24,140 ₹4,014 ₹16,892
28 Jul ₹19,110 ₹6,779 ₹17,700
24 Jul ₹24,114 ₹2,514 ₹17,119
17 Jul ₹20,684 ₹2,003 ₹18,009
10 Jul ₹26,002 ₹3,093 ₹18,899
07 Jul ₹17,509 ₹8,519 ₹11,119
03 Jul ₹29,999 ₹5,669 ₹20,169
30 Jun ₹28,669 ₹5,509 ₹18,099
19 Jun ₹28,599 ₹3,030 ₹19,418
16 Jun ₹27,669 ₹3,611 ₹18,866
